Murphy Brown is Coming Back and Why We Desperately Need Her

This last week it was announced that the popular sitcom Murphy Brown, which debuted in 1988 and ran for 247 episodes, will be returning to television. CBS has greenlit a 13-episode revival of one of television’s most politically charged sitcoms and has secured the series’ original star Candice Bergan to return in the title role. With so many TV shows returning from what we all assumed was their entertainment graves (Full HouseRoseanneWill & Grace), we cannot help but be slightly more intrigued by what this renaissance will bring in the guise of television’s highly opinionated and vocal liberal.

Will & Grace: Is the Revival of this Sitcom Worth Your Time?

I was (and still am) an ardent fan of the original run of the sitcom Will & Grace. Though it sometimes tended toward the absurd and lunatic, it was often on-the-money in its depiction of the struggles of gay men and their close female friends (unceremoniously referred to as “hags”). The show was groundbreaking in many ways, but predominantly as a sitcom with a gay male lead it cut a new swath through American living rooms, opening some minds and creating important dialogues with others.
